Unbalance in day and night due to inclination of Earth in its axis
(Inclination of Earth's Axis Earth axis is lilted at an angle 23
1/2° from a perpendicular to the orbital plane.or Earth's maker
an angle of 66 1/2° with the plane of Earth's Orbit)

Because of this constant inclination in on direction, the Northern


Hemisphere remains inclined towards the sun or faces the sun
4 Adda247 | No. 1 APP for Banking & SSC Preparation
Website: store.adda247.com | Email: ebooks@adda247.com
during one half of the year. Therefore a large part of this
hemisphere receiver sunlight. resultingdaysare longer and nights
are shorter.
The southern hemisphere is away from the sun. Ittherefore, has
shorter days and longer nights. During the other half of the year,
the southern Hemispheresis inclined towards the sun. Hence it has
longer days and shorter nights.
When the Northern hemisphere is inclined towards the sun, the
North Pole will have no night and South Pole will have no day and
vice versa.
It is only the equator that the day and night are of equal length.
As we move away from the equator towards either hemisphere, the
difference between the length of day and night generally goes on
increasing

Palk Strait is a strait between Tamil Nadu state of India & the
Mannar distt. of the Northern Province of the island nation of Sri
Lanka.
